- Sujet
- This gene encodes a deadenylase that functions as the catalytic subunit of the polyadenylate binding protein dependent poly(A) nuclease complex. The encoded protein is a magnesium dependent 3' to 5' exoribonuclease that is involved in the degradation of cytoplasmic mRNAs. Alternate splicing results in multiple transcript variants.
